The Knicks played very good defense for the majority of the game— but in the end, it was their defense that did them in.
First, the Knicks allowed an inexcusable alley oop to Kevin Garnett, bringing their three point lead down to one. Then, thanks to a Oscar awarding winning flop by Paul Pierce (he accepted a gold wheelchair after the game), the Celtics got the ball back on a very suspect offensive foul against Carmelo Anthony.
